Jump to content

ssh-keygen: /root/.ssh/known_hosts: No such file or directory


Jazz
 Share

Recommended Posts

Jag sitter och pillar med min nya server nu då va och har stött på ett litet problem, jag kan helt plötsligt inte längre ansluta via SSH och har försökt åtgärda det på samma sätt som den här killen men med lika lite framgång.

Jag kan alltså helt plötsligt inte längre ansluta till min server via SSH eftersom host key verification failar. Först trodde jag att det var ett fel i servern, vilket det förstås är, men det failar bara när jag ansluter från min mac. Genom PuTTY via Windows och från min iPad går det hur bra som helst och jag vet inte vad jag ska göra, jag vill ju självfallet även kunna ansluta via min laptop...

Problemet är alltså att kommandot

ssh-keygen -R server
inte fungerar eftersom felmeddelandet
ssh-keygen: /root/.ssh/known_hosts: No such file or directory

Finns det någon som har någon erfarenhet av detta?

Redigerad av Jazz
Länk till kommentar
Dela på andra sidor

Skrivet (redigerad)

Hmm. Har aldrig genererat nycklar för automatiserad SSH-tillgång tidigare. Vilket jag antar det är du gör.

Funkar det om du loggar in på SSH som vanligt? Med lösenord.

Det är ju det jag gör, loggar in som root med lösenord och via PuTTY, iPad och allt annat går det bra men när jag gör det från macen får man:

@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@

@ W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ED! @

@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@

IT IS POSSIBLE THAT SOMEONE IS DOING SOMETHING NASTY!

Someone could be eavesdropping on you right now (man-in-the-middle attack)!

It is also possible that the RSA host key has just been changed.

The fingerprint for the RSA key sent by the remote host is

5c:9b:16:56:a6:cd:11:10:3a:cd:1b:a2:91:cd:e5:1c.

Please contact your system administrator.

Add correct host key in /home/user/.ssh/known_hosts to get rid of this message.

Offending key in /home/user/.ssh/known_hosts:1

RSA host key for ras.mydomain.com has changed and you have requested strict checking.

Host key verification failed.

Redigerad av Jazz
Länk till kommentar
Dela på andra sidor

Händer det även om du inte loggar in som root?

Jag antar att du kör Debian. Kom ihåg att inte göra det till en vana att logga in som Root. Onödiga risker. ;)

http://superuser.com/a/271673 ifall du inte prövat det än.

Jepp, det verkar vara just klientrelaterat mellan macen och servern. Hehe, nä, jag rootar mest nu i början eftersom jag inte pallar suda hela tiden.

Länk till kommentar
Dela på andra sidor

Skrivet (redigerad)

Har du dubbelcheckat hertzmotorn? Jag hade det problemet en gång...

Inga problem, mongosmörnivåerna är överfulla...

Edit: Fuck allt, det visade sig att det var hertzmotorn ändå. I felmeddelandet pekades det på mappen /users/hostname/.ssh ... vilket jag trodde refererade till en mapp på servern. Nyckelfelet låg inte alls på Ubuntu-sidan, utan i macen... gick in i rätt mapp, raderade known_hosts och nu kan jag åter ansluta. Gaaaaaaah. Så jävla mycket bortslösad tid... även om man lärde sig en hel del.

Redigerad av Jazz
Länk till kommentar
Dela på andra sidor

Inga problem, mongosmörnivåerna är överfulla...

Edit: Fuck allt, det visade sig att det var hertzmotorn ändå. I felmeddelandet pekades det på mappen /users/hostname/.ssh ... vilket jag trodde refererade till en mapp på servern. Nyckelfelet låg inte alls på Ubuntu-sidan, utan i macen... gick in i rätt mapp, raderade known_hosts och nu kan jag åter ansluta. Gaaaaaaah. Så jävla mycket bortslösad tid... även om man lärde sig en hel del.

dAgeI_1246417_0.gif

Hur går det i övrigt med servern? Har du kommit igång med "vardagsanvändning" ännu? Om du inte har något emot att jag är lite nyfiken.

  • Gilla 1
Länk till kommentar
Dela på andra sidor

Skrivet (redigerad)

dAgeI_1246417_0.gif

Hur går det i övrigt med servern? Har du kommit igång med "vardagsanvändning" ännu? Om du inte har något emot att jag är lite nyfiken.

Jorå, bara bra, utökade med ytterligare 4 GB RAM innan jag installerade mjukvaran (på ett USB-minne via den interna USB-platsen, mycket behändigt) och förutom en del klantigheter som att chmodda sig åt helvete och SSH-tramset så rullar det på. Följer den här guiden (du har inget bättre tips?) då den säger åt mig exakt vad man ska göra och inkluderar de funktioner jag vill åt. Den står inte på 24/7 än men behovet för det lär ju uppstå inom det snaraste. Sjukt kul att konfigurera!

Redigerad av Jazz
Länk till kommentar
Dela på andra sidor

Jorå, bara bra, utökade med ytterligare 4 GB RAM innan jag installerade mjukvaran (på ett USB-minne via den interna USB-platsen, mycket behändigt) och förutom en del klantigheter som att chmodda sig åt helvete och SSH-tramset så rullar det på. Följer den här guiden (du har inget bättre tips?) då den säger åt mig exakt vad man ska göra och inkluderar de funktioner jag vill åt. Den står inte på 24/7 än men behovet för det lär ju uppstå inom det snaraste. Sjukt kul att konfigurera!

Hmm. Jag har aldrig använt Ubuntu Server själv. Efter rekommendation körde jag direkt på Debian vilket är mycket mer avskalat än Ubuntu. Behöver man något så installerar man bara just det. En lite mer hardcore approach kanske. Men resten är ju i princip det samma.

Guiden verkar väldigt genomförlig. How To Forge har hjälpt mig innan så jag skulle vilja säga att du är i goda händer iaf.

  • Gilla 1
Länk till kommentar
Dela på andra sidor

Hmm. Jag har aldrig använt Ubuntu Server själv. Efter rekommendation körde jag direkt på Debian vilket är mycket mer avskalat än Ubuntu. Behöver man något så installerar man bara just det. En lite mer hardcore approach kanske. Men resten är ju i princip det samma.

Guiden verkar väldigt genomförlig. How To Forge har hjälpt mig innan så jag skulle vilja säga att du är i goda händer iaf.

Vad jag förstod så var det egentligen ingen större skillnad på dem... vilken release rekommenderar du och varför?

Länk till kommentar
Dela på andra sidor

Vad jag förstod så var det egentligen ingen större skillnad på dem... vilken release rekommenderar du och varför?

Eh, Debians versioner är döpta efter karaktärerna i Toy Story. Behöver jag säga mer?

Okej, kanske.

Är insnöad på Debian här så det är väl mest det. Debian är som jag tidigare sa mer avskalat. Du kan när du installerar det få välja en installation som egentligen bara består utav det viktigaste. Detta sparar på hårddiskutrymme och minimal prestanda. Ubuntu har vad jag vet en hel del (onödiga) program som tuggar i bakgrunden.

Men allt det åt sidan. Anledningen till att folk väljer Debian till servrar är stabiliteten. Till skillnad mot Ubuntu som släpps varje halvår (förutom LTS) har Debian 2-3 år mellan sina versioner. Varje version testas minutiöst och skarp version får inte släppas förrän bevisat stabil.

Senaste stabila är 6.0 "Squeeze". Nästa version heter "Wheezy". Som du ser här så frös man versionen redan i Juni. Att frysa innebär att man inte får lägga till mer funktioner. Utan man färdigställer det som påbörjats. Sen dess har det kommit ut fyra betor och en releasekandidat. Vi får hoppas på en release "snart". ;)

Förlåt om det verkar som att jag dumförklarar dig. Har ingen aning om vilken nivå du ligger på.

  • Gilla 1
Länk till kommentar
Dela på andra sidor

Eh, Debians versioner är döpta efter karaktärerna i Toy Story. Behöver jag säga mer?

Okej, kanske.

Är insnöad på Debian här så det är väl mest det. Debian är som jag tidigare sa mer avskalat. Du kan när du installerar det få välja en installation som egentligen bara består utav det viktigaste. Detta sparar på hårddiskutrymme och minimal prestanda. Ubuntu har vad jag vet en hel del (onödiga) program som tuggar i bakgrunden.

Men allt det åt sidan. Anledningen till att folk väljer Debian till servrar är stabiliteten. Till skillnad mot Ubuntu som släpps varje halvår (förutom LTS) har Debian 2-3 år mellan sina versioner. Varje version testas minutiöst och skarp version får inte släppas förrän bevisat stabil.

Senaste stabila är 6.0 "Squeeze". Nästa version heter "Wheezy". Som du ser här så frös man versionen redan i Juni. Att frysa innebär att man inte får lägga till mer funktioner. Utan man färdigställer det som påbörjats. Sen dess har det kommit ut fyra betor och en releasekandidat. Vi får hoppas på en release "snart". ;)

Förlåt om det verkar som att jag dumförklarar dig. Har ingen aning om vilken nivå du ligger på.

Här dumförklaras ingen! Ingenting är skrivet i sten ännu och jag har inte gjort något seriöst ännu faktiskt. Tror att jag ska ta mig en titt på Debian ändå, du säljer ju det bra... och så har man förstås live-support via forumet 24/7? ;)

Länk till kommentar
Dela på andra sidor

Haha, najs. Finns det en lika detaljerad tutorial vad gäller Debian som den jag följde i Ubuntu?

Mycket är samma. Vissa steg som innebar att stänga av saker (AppArmor tex) behöver du inte göra eftersom Debian inte ens skickar med dem.

  • Hur långt i guiden följde du?
  • Har du RAID konfigurerat? I mjuk- eller hårdvara?

  • Gilla 1
Länk till kommentar
Dela på andra sidor

Skrivet (redigerad)

Mycket är samma. Vissa steg som innebar att stänga av saker (AppArmor tex) behöver du inte göra eftersom Debian inte ens skickar med dem.

  • Hur långt i guiden följde du?
  • Har du RAID konfigurerat? I mjuk- eller hårdvara?

Fick ett ryck och testade Debian, märker ingen större skillnad egentligen vilket jag i och för sig inte hade väntat mig. Däremot känns det stabilt och jag har lyckats konfigurera en del grejer som jag inte fattade med Ubuntu.

Ingen RAID nej, inte än, har för få diskar.

Hittade och har följt den en bit, installerade dock stöd för MySQL och PHP i ett tidigare skede och det fungerade fint!

Hur skapar man egentligen ett sådant här system?: http://hypem.com/download/

Redigerad av Jazz
Länk till kommentar
Dela på andra sidor

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Gäst
Skriv inlägg...

×   Innehåll kopierat inklusive formatering.   Ta bort formatering

  Only 75 emoji are allowed.

×   Din länk har expanderats till ett media-block.   Visa länk istället

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

×
×
  • Create New...